Is Caffeine Bad for Autoimmune Disease? A Complex Relationship

Autoimmune diseases, a group of conditions where the body's immune system mistakenly attacks its own tissues, affect millions worldwide. Managing these conditions often involves a multifaceted approach, including medication, lifestyle adjustments, and dietary changes. One dietary component frequently questioned is caffeine, a ubiquitous stimulant found in coffee, tea, chocolate, and energy drinks. The question of whether caffeine is bad for autoimmune disease is complex and lacks a simple yes or no answer. While some studies suggest potential negative effects, others find minimal impact or even potential benefits, highlighting the need for individual consideration and nuanced understanding.

The Potential Downsides: Inflammation and Adrenal Fatigue

The primary concern surrounding caffeine consumption in individuals with autoimmune diseases centers around its potential to exacerbate inflammation and contribute to adrenal fatigue.

  • Inflammation: Many autoimmune diseases are characterized by chronic inflammation. Some research suggests that caffeine can stimulate the release of inflammatory cytokines, potentially worsening symptoms in susceptible individuals. This effect isn't universally observed, and the magnitude of the inflammatory response can vary significantly based on factors such as individual sensitivity, caffeine intake levels, and the specific autoimmune condition. For instance, a person with rheumatoid arthritis might experience increased joint pain and stiffness after consuming caffeine, while someone with lupus might see no noticeable change.

  • Adrenal Fatigue: The adrenal glands produce cortisol, a crucial hormone involved in stress response and immune regulation. Chronic stress, including the stress placed on the body by an autoimmune disease, can lead to adrenal fatigue – a state of adrenal gland exhaustion. While not a formally recognized medical condition, adrenal fatigue is often associated with symptoms like fatigue, brain fog, low blood pressure, and salt cravings. Because caffeine can stimulate the adrenal glands in the short term, some argue that chronic caffeine consumption might contribute to adrenal fatigue over time by overworking these glands, ultimately hindering their ability to regulate the immune system effectively.

  • Gut Health: A growing body of research emphasizes the crucial role of the gut microbiome in immune function. Some studies suggest that caffeine can disrupt the gut microbiota, potentially leading to increased intestinal permeability ("leaky gut"), a phenomenon associated with autoimmune disease exacerbation. An unhealthy gut can allow undigested food particles and toxins to enter the bloodstream, triggering an immune response and worsening inflammation.

  • Sleep Disruption: Caffeine's stimulating effects can interfere with sleep quality, and poor sleep is linked to increased inflammation and a weakened immune system. Individuals with autoimmune diseases often experience fatigue and sleep disturbances as symptoms, making caffeine-induced sleep disruption particularly problematic.

Potential Benefits and Nuances

Despite the potential drawbacks, some research suggests that moderate caffeine consumption might not negatively impact, or even offer potential benefits to, individuals with certain autoimmune diseases.

  • Antioxidant Properties: Caffeine possesses antioxidant properties, which can help protect cells from damage caused by free radicals. Oxidative stress contributes to inflammation, so caffeine's antioxidant capacity could potentially mitigate some inflammatory processes. However, this benefit needs to be carefully weighed against the potential pro-inflammatory effects.

  • Cognitive Function: Many individuals with autoimmune diseases experience "brain fog" and cognitive impairment. Caffeine's stimulating effects on the central nervous system might temporarily improve alertness and focus, potentially offering some cognitive benefits. This effect, however, is temporary and shouldn't mask the need for appropriate medical management of underlying cognitive issues.

  • Pain Management: Some individuals report that caffeine helps manage pain associated with autoimmune conditions. This is likely due to its mild analgesic effects, potentially acting synergistically with other pain-relieving strategies.

Individual Variability and the Importance of Self-Experimentation

The effects of caffeine on autoimmune disease are highly individual. Factors such as genetics, the specific autoimmune condition, the severity of the disease, overall health, and caffeine metabolism all play a role in determining an individual's response. What might exacerbate symptoms in one person could be harmless or even beneficial to another.

Therefore, a trial-and-error approach guided by self-observation and potentially consultation with a healthcare professional is often necessary. Individuals with autoimmune diseases should pay close attention to how their body reacts to caffeine. This involves monitoring symptoms like inflammation, fatigue, pain, gut issues, and sleep quality after consuming caffeinated beverages. Keeping a detailed diary can be helpful in tracking these responses.

Recommendations and Cautions

  • Moderate Consumption: If you choose to consume caffeine, do so in moderation. Start with small amounts and observe your body's response. Avoid excessive caffeine intake, particularly before bed.

  • Listen to Your Body: Pay close attention to how you feel after consuming caffeine. If you notice any worsening of symptoms, reduce your intake or eliminate caffeine altogether.

  • Consult Your Doctor: Discuss caffeine consumption with your doctor or a registered dietitian, especially if you have a severe autoimmune disease or are taking other medications. They can help you determine an appropriate level of caffeine intake based on your individual circumstances.

  • Consider Alternatives: Explore caffeine-free alternatives such as herbal teas or decaffeinated coffee if you experience negative effects from caffeine.

  • Focus on Holistic Management: Remember that caffeine is just one piece of the puzzle. Managing autoimmune disease effectively requires a holistic approach that encompasses various lifestyle factors, including diet, exercise, stress management, and adequate sleep.

In conclusion, the relationship between caffeine and autoimmune disease is nuanced and complex. While potential negative effects, particularly regarding inflammation and adrenal fatigue, exist, individual responses vary significantly. A mindful approach involving moderation, self-observation, and communication with healthcare professionals is crucial for determining the optimal level of caffeine consumption, or its complete elimination, for individuals with autoimmune conditions. The focus should always remain on optimizing overall health and well-being through a comprehensive and personalized management plan.
